In this review, we present the recent work of the author in comparison with various related results obtained by other authors in literature. We first recall the stability, contractivity and asymptotic stability results of the true solution to nonlinear stiff Volterra functional differential equations (VFDEs), then a series of stability, contractivity, asymptotic stability and B-convergence results of Runge-Kutta methods for VFDEs is presented in detail. This work provides a unified theoretical foundation for the theoretical and numerical analysis of nonlinear stiff problems in delay differential equations (DDEs), integro-differential equations (IDEs), delayintegro-differential equations (DIDEs) and VFDEs of other type which appear in practice.   相似文献

This paper is concerned with the dissipativity of theoretical solutions to nonlinear Volterra functional differential equations (VFDEs). At first, we give some generalizations of Halanay's inequality which play an important role in study of dissipativity and stability of differential equations. Then, by applying the generalization of Halanay's inequality, the dissipativity results of VFDEs are obtained, which provides unified theoretical foundation for the dissipativity analysis of systems in ordinary differential equations (ODEs), delay differential equations (DDEs), integro-differential equations (IDEs), Volterra delay-integro-differential equations (VDIDEs) and VFDEs of other type which appear in practice.  相似文献

This paper is concerned with the numerical dissipativity of nonlinear Volterra functional differential equations (VFDEs). We give some dissipativity results of Runge-Kutta methods when they are applied to VFDEs. These results provide unified theoretical foundation for the numerical dissipativity analysis of systems in ordinary differential equations (ODEs), delay differential equations (DDEs), integro-differential equations (IDEs), Volterra delay integro-differential equations (VDIDEs) and VFDEs of other type which appear in practice. Numerical examples are given to confirm our theoretical results.  相似文献

The authors establish the existence and stability of standing wave solutions of a nonlinear singularly perturbed systemof integral differential equations and a nonlinear scalar integral differential equation. It will be shown that there exist six standing wave solutions (u(x,t),w(x,t))=(U(x),W(x)) to the nonlinear singularly perturbed system of integral differential equations. Similarly, there exist six standing wave solutions u(x,t)=U(x) to the nonlinear scalar integral differential equation. The main idea to establish the stability is to construct Evans functions corresponding to several associated eigenvalue problems.  相似文献

An integrating factor mixed with Runge-Kutta technique is a time integration method that can be efficiently combined with spatial spectral approximations to provide a very high resolution to the smooth solutions of some linear and nonlinear partial differential equations. In this paper, the novel hybrid Fourier-Galerkin Runge-Kutta scheme, with the aid of an integrating factor, is proposed to solve nonlinear high-order stiff PDEs. Error analysis and properties of the scheme are provided. Application to the approximate solution of the nonlinear stiff Korteweg-de Vries (the 3rd order PDE, dispersive equation), Kuramoto-Sivashinsky (the 4th order PDE, dissipative equation) and Kawahara (the 5th order PDE) equations are presented. Comparisons are made between this proposed scheme and the competing method given by Kassam and Trefethen. It is found that for KdV, KS and Kawahara equations, the proposed method is the best.  相似文献

Summary This paper deals with the solution of partitioned systems of nonlinear stiff differential equations. Given a differential system, the user may specify some equations to be stiff and others to be nonstiff. For the numerical solution of such a system partitioned adaptive Runge-Kutta methods are studied. Nonstiff equations are integrated by an explicit Runge-Kutta method while an adaptive Runge-Kutta method is used for the stiff part of the system.The paper discusses numerical stability and contractivity as well as the implementation and usage of such compound methods. Test results for three partitioned stiff initial value problems for different tolerances are presented.  相似文献

Under linear expectation(or classical probability), the stability for stochastic differential delay equations(SDDEs), where their coeficients are either linear or nonlinear but bounded by linear functions, has been investigated intensively. Recently, the stability of highly nonlinear hybrid stochastic differential equations is studied by some researchers. In this paper,by using Peng's G-expectation theory, we first prove the existence and uniqueness of solutions to SDDEs driven by G-Brownian motion(G-SDDEs) under local Lipschitz and linear growth conditions. Then the second kind of stability and the dependence of the solutions to G-SDDEs are studied. Finally, we explore the stability and boundedness of highly nonlinear G-SDDEs.  相似文献

In this paper, we consider reaction–diffusion systems arising from two-component predator–prey models with Smith growth functional response. The mathematical approach used here is in two folds since the time-dependent partial differential equations consist of both linear and nonlinear terms. We discretize the stiff or moderately stiff term with the fourth-order difference operator and advance the resulting nonlinear system of ordinary differential equations with the two competing families of the exponential time differencing (ETD) schemes, and we analyze them for stability. Numerical comparison between these two methods for solving various predator–prey population models with functional responses are also presented. Numerical results show that the techniques require less computational work. Also in the numerical results, some emerging spatial patterns are unveiled.  相似文献

This paper deals with numerical solutions of nonlinear stiff stochastic differential equations with jump-diffusion and piecewise continuous arguments. By combining compensated split-step methods and balanced methods, a class of compensated split-step balanced (CSSB) methods are suggested for solving the equations. Based on the one-sided Lipschitz condition and local Lipschitz condition, a strong convergence criterion of CSSB methods is derived. It is proved under some suitable conditions that the numerical solutions produced by CSSB methods can preserve the mean-square exponential stability of the corresponding analytical solutions. Several numerical examples are presented to illustrate the obtained theoretical results and the effectiveness of CSSB methods. Moreover, in order to show the computational advantage of CSSB methods, we also give a numerical comparison with the adapted split-step backward Euler methods with or without compensation and tamed explicit methods.

We study the stability preservation problem while passing from ordinary differential to difference equations. Using the method of Lyapunov functions, we determine the conditions under which the asymptotic stability of the zero solutions to systems of differential equations implies that the zero solutions to the corresponding difference systems are asymptotically stable as well. We prove a theorem on the stability of perturbed systems, estimate the duration of transition processes for some class of systems of nonlinear difference equations, and study the conditions of the stability of complex systems in nonlinear approximation.  相似文献

The class of linearly-implicit parallel two-step peer W-methods has been designed recently for efficient numerical solutions of stiff ordinary differential equations. Those schemes allow for parallelism across the method, that is an important feature for implementation on modern computational devices. Most importantly, all stage values of those methods possess the same properties in terms of stability and accuracy of numerical integration. This property results in the fact that no order reduction occurs when they are applied to very stiff problems. In this paper, we develop parallel local and global error estimation schemes that allow the numerical solution to be computed for a user-supplied accuracy requirement in automatic mode. An algorithm of such global error control and other technical particulars are also discussed here. Numerical examples confirm efficiency of the presented error estimation and stepsize control algorithm on a number of test problems with known exact solutions, including nonstiff, stiff, very stiff and large-scale differential equations. A comparison with the well-known stiff solver RODAS is also shown.  相似文献

In this paper, we first introduce the test problem classes with respect to the initial value problems of nonlinear stiff impulsive differential equations in Banach spaces. The stability and asymptotic stability results of the analytic solution of the above-mentioned problems are obtained. As an example of discretization methods, the numerical stability and asymptotic stability results of the implicit Euler method are also given.  相似文献
